A Historical Odyssey

The story of medicine is as old as civilization itself. Millennia ago, our ancestors turned to nature’s bounty for remedies to alleviate ailments and cure diseases. Plants, minerals, and even animal parts were meticulously studied and utilized for their medicinal properties. Ancient civilizations such as the Egyptians, Greeks, and Chinese left behind rich legacies of medical knowledge, laying the foundation for the practice of medicine as we know it today.

The Pillars of Modern Medicine

Modern medicine rests upon several key pillars, each contributing to the vast array of treatments available to patients worldwide:

  1. Pharmaceuticals: Central to modern healthcare, pharmaceuticals encompass a wide range of drugs designed to prevent, treat, or cure diseases. From painkillers to chemotherapy agents, pharmaceuticals have transformed the prognosis of countless conditions, offering hope and relief to millions.
  2. Vaccines: Vaccination stands as one of the greatest triumphs of medicine, effectively eradicating or controlling once-deadly diseases like smallpox, polio, and measles. By harnessing the body’s immune system, vaccines confer immunity against pathogens, safeguarding individuals and communities from epidemics.
  3. Biotechnology: The marriage of biology and technology has given rise to a new era of medicine, characterized by the development of biologics, gene therapies, and personalized medicine. Biotechnology holds immense promise for treating previously incurable diseases and tailoring treatments to individual genetic profiles.
  4. Traditional Medicine: Despite the march of progress, traditional forms of medicine continue to play a significant role in healthcare, especially in cultures where they are deeply rooted. Practices like acupuncture, herbalism, and Ayurveda offer alternative approaches to wellness, complementing conventional treatments in an integrative framework.
